Job description

Compensation Administrative Support Specialist

This role provides administrative support to the compensation department’s team and programs that attract, retain, motivate and reward employees while ensuring internal equity, external competitiveness and governmental compliance. Collaborate with team members to learn compensation programs, HR systems, software, and the intricacies of an evolving workforce. Follows processes and procedures to provide compensation data support administering, reconciling, and implementing wage changes.

JOB R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Runs biweekly, monthly and quarterly audit reports. Reviews output, recommends corrective action to correct data discrepancies, prepares Workday changes to correct discrepancies, and validates changes in test and live environment.
  • Maintains the team InSCIder site with guidance from analysts and managers.
  • Prepares monthly employee data upload. Requests peer review, makes applicable revisions and uploads file. Reviews upload output to understand issues, revise data, and re-upload, if needed.
  • Provides ongoing support to the compensation team on a wide variety of compensation related issues. Learn and understand various compensation program policies, plan documents, SOPs and job aids to understand guidelines and procedures.
  • Completes assigned responsibilities in support of annual processes such as the salary review (merit) and incentive compensation processes. Discusses questions and issues with process owner or project administrator.
  • Monitors team HEAT tickets daily and assigns them to the appropriate team member. Monitors the Corporate Compensation email folder and forwards inquiries to the appropriate team member or responds on behalf of the team. Discusses non-routine issues with senior team members for guidance or escalation.
  • Manages workload and priorities to deliver timely accurate results.
  • Maintains and updates job descriptions. May draft initial job descriptions for review by senior compensation team members.
  • Drafts SOPs and job aids for review and approval.
  • May review and reconcile eligibility data identifying issues for multiple programs then notifies applicable team member for resolution.
  • Participates in compensation systems and materials tests for business, functional, UAT, data accuracy, mathematical accuracy, and job aid helpfulness.
  • May assist with tracking and implementing minimum wage changes which includes identifying associates below their respective minimum wage and preparing pay adjustments to process changes including preparing uploads, validating data and submitting final changes. Documents, processes and tests Workday configuration changes. Ensures compliance with local, state, and federal regulations.
  • May assist with the distribution of the Total Rewards Statements for Officers and eligible executive compensation participants.
  • May assist with the coordination and distribution of the annual compensation summary sheets for incentive compensation and PUP payments.
